Oak Floor Replacement in Phoenix, AZ
Oak floor replacement services involve removing existing hardwood flooring and installing new oak planks to restore or upgrade the appearance of a property’s flooring. These projects typically cover entire rooms, hallways, or even multiple areas within a home, and are often requested when existing floors are damaged, worn out, or outdated. Homeowners usually seek this service to improve the aesthetic appeal, enhance durability, or address issues such as warping, staining, or extensive scratches that cannot be repaired through refinishing alone.
Before requesting oak floor replacement, property owners should consider the condition of their current flooring, including whether the subfloor is stable and suitable for new installation. It’s also helpful to understand the different finishes, plank styles, and stain options available to match the desired look of the space. Additionally, knowing the scope of the project-such as whether the entire floor or specific sections need replacement-can ensure clear communication and proper planning for the work.

Oak Floor Replacement Questions
What are common signs that oak floors need replacement? Visible damage such as deep scratches, warping, or significant staining can indicate the need for replacement rather than repair.
Can oak flooring be refinished instead of replaced? Yes, many minor damages can be addressed through refinishing, but extensive damage may require full replacement.
What types of projects typically involve oak floor replacement? Projects include remodeling, addressing water damage, or upgrading worn-out flooring in residential or commercial spaces.
What should property owners consider before replacing oak floors? It's important to evaluate the extent of damage, the desired look, and compatibility with existing interior design before proceeding.
